Peter B. Allport is an associate in the law firm of McDermott Will & Emery LLP and is based in the Firm’s Chicago office.
While in law school, Peter externed for the Honorable Bruce Black of the U.S. Bankruptcy Court of the Northern District of Illinois. He was also a participant in the Julius H. Miner Moot Court Competition.
Peter received his J.D. from Northwestern University School of Law. He earned his M.A. in European history and his B.A. in history from Tulane University.
Peter is admitted to practice in the state of Illinois.
